    Reserve Marines, Air National Guard join forces to help Boy Scouts of America [Image 2 of 4]

    Reserve Marines, Air National Guard join forces to help Boy Scouts of America

    RAYMOND, ME, UNITED STATES

    07.10.2014

    Photo by Sgt. Adwin Esters 

    Marine Forces Reserve (MARFORRES)

    Sgt. Zackery Martinez, combat engineer with 6th Engineer Support Battalion and native of Battle Creek, Michigan, cuts a rafter beam to the correct measurements for a pavilion on the new 100-meter range being built for the Boy Scouts of America during the joint service Innovative Readiness Training on Camp William Hinds in Raymond, Maine, July 10, 2014. IRT Camp Hinds is a joint service initiative designed to provide service members with real-world training opportunities preparing them for their war-time missions while also supporting the needs of America’s underserved communities.
